You can get the current $500 rebate from Dodge on the R/T.

When I bought my RC R/T (it has every option except overhead console) I had
the $500 new buyers rebate and a $400 new graduate rebate. I then
negotiated the best deal I could, then they had to come down the extra $900.
My dealer was kind of unwilling to deal at first, he thought that the Mopar
bedliner and bug shield they put on should add $400 to the MSRP of $22,100
so I told him he was crazy. So I spent the rest of the day (I spent an
entire Saturday arguing with them) being as annoying as I could and waving
the cash around in their face....I even asked customers that were coming in
(right in front of the manager no less), if they thought a cheap plastic
bedliner and bug shield were worth $400! Most of them said 'no' and when I
explained how unreasonable the the dealership was being, some of the
customers turned around and left. That is when they finally decided they
had some room to deal on the R/T. When I was all said and done the R/T
listed for $22,500...and I drove!
it away for $20K. I figure the
dealer still made $2-3K on the truck, but at least I didn't pay list price
like they first told me I would have to.
